Output 5630cdf953e9b7c906e5f1a1cfffa337ccddd64e8fccf1fb5c1f4ebde448e28a:1

value
1018498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4705c61a877a713d23a487e5613ddc500fea9c7 OP_EQUAL
address
3J96A3SvS7bMGBPvPuKf3zm35JtWFS9zGX
transaction
5630cdf953e9b7c906e5f1a1cfffa337ccddd64e8fccf1fb5c1f4ebde448e28a
confirmations
336341
spent
true